I'll go first! One memory that always makes me smile is from my last year of high school. Our class was especially mischievous, and we had a substitute teacher for our geography class one day. Determined to keep us in line, she began the lesson with a warning: "I know some of you are thinking of causing trouble, but I won't tolerate any misbehavior."

Well, that only egged us on! Someone started a whisper chain, and soon half the class was whispering, then giggling. The teacher demanded to know what was going on, but no one would budge. So, she did something unexpected. She whipped out a deck of cards and challenged anyone who could do a cool card trick!

The classroom went wild, and we spent the next 10 minutes in awe of this seemingly cool teacher. It turned out to be a great lesson, with everyone participating eagerly. That sub teacher definitely won us over and made an otherwise mundane day unforgettable.

That's a fun thread to start! My most memorable school incident involved a teacher too - though it's not quite as heartwarming as yours!

In 6th grade, we had a strict math teacher who was notorious for her no-nonsense attitude and harsh penalties for even minor misdemeanors. One day, she caught a student cheating during a test - this poor kid had hidden some notes in his sleeve, which he'd intended to slyly glance at. When the teacher discovered this, she marched him to the front of the class, pulled back his blazer sleeve roughly, and proceeded to deliver a lecture on honesty and integrity that felt like an eternity.

As she was speaking, though, something even more entertaining was happening. The boy's sleeve had been pulled up so roughly that it revealed not just his notes, but also a large collection of Band-Aids stuck all over his arm - each one hiding a tiny cartoon character. The whole class burst into laughter, which only grew when the poor guy started frantically trying to cover them up, unable to decide whether the embarrassment of his secret being unveiled was worse than the wrath of the teacher.

Needless to say, the serious mood broke, and we spent the next few minutes in a giggling frenzy. It didn't end well for the cheater, as the teacher gave him a week's detention. But in that moment of hilarity, all the tension from her strict teaching melted away, and we saw a rare glimpse of fun behind the no-nonsense facade.

It's those quirky, unexpected moments that make school life so memorable!
